In the '99, if you hit the remote lock button once, the doors will lock. If you hit the lock button twice, the horn will toot once and the lights will blink so fast, you barely notice it in broad daylight.

When you unlock the doors with the remote, the interior and cargo lights will go on. Click it once and only the driver's door will unlock. Hit the button twice, and both doors will unlock.

Well, when I hit the unlock button one time, it unlocks only the driver side door, but no lights go on in the cab. If I hit the unlock button twice, then both sides unlock, and the interior lights and the cargo light go on.
When I hit the lock button once, it just locks the doors, but no honk or lights (headlight, foglight, taillight) flash. If I hit the lock button twice, then it locks both doors, and honks, and flashes the lights. Hope this helps out!!!

If you have the remote keless entry the horn will chirp and headlights flash when you lock it with the remote, if the horn chirps twice, there is a door that is not fully closed. When walking towards it and unlocking the interior lights will come on, I think you have to unlock it twice for that to happen, not sure, also the cargo light will come on.
